WebAbstract Means of enhancing the organisational and expressive power of semantic nets<227> through the grouping of nodes and links, associated with Hendrix. Nodes and links may figure in one or more ‘spaces’, which may themselves be bundled into higherlevel ‘vistas’, which can be exploited autonomously and structured hierarchically.
